What's This "Life Cycle" Thing, Anyway?

Imagine you're planting a seed. First, you nurture it, right? Then it sprouts, grows strong, maybe even bears fruit! Eventually, it might wither. The Product Life Cycle is kinda like that. It describes the different stages a product goes through from the moment it’s conceived to the time it's taken off the market. Each stage has unique characteristics, affecting how companies market and sell their goods.

So, what are these magical stages?

Stage 1: Introduction - The New Kid on the Block

This is where it all begins! Think of it as the product being born. It's brand new, maybe even a little quirky. Sales are usually slow because, well, nobody knows about it yet! Companies are spending big bucks on marketing, trying to create buzz. Profit margins are often low (or even negative!) because of those hefty startup costs. It's risky, but the potential reward is huge!

Remember the first smartphones? They were clunky, expensive, and not everyone understood them. That was the introduction stage. Think of electric cars in the early 2000s. A cool idea, but definitely not mainstream.

Stage 2: Growth - Taking Off!

Woohoo! People are catching on! Sales start to climb, and word-of-mouth is your best friend. Your product is gaining traction, and other companies are starting to notice. Profits are looking good! This is where you start refining your product, maybe adding new features to stay ahead of the (inevitable) competition. Marketing shifts from just raising awareness to building brand loyalty.

Think about streaming services like Netflix or Spotify a few years back. They weren’t new, but they were rapidly gaining subscribers and expanding their content libraries. That's the growth stage in action!

Stage 3: Maturity - King (or Queen) of the Hill

You've made it! Your product is a household name. Sales are at their peak, and you’re reaping the rewards. But hold on! This is also where things get tricky. Competition is fierce, and growth starts to slow down. You need to fight to maintain your market share. This means finding new ways to appeal to customers, maybe through price cuts, promotions, or product improvements.

Consider classic products like Coca-Cola or toothpaste. They've been around forever and are constantly battling for shelf space with competitors. They're mature products navigating a saturated market.

Stage 4: Decline - The Sun Sets

Uh oh… sales are starting to decline. Maybe newer, better products have come along. Maybe consumer tastes have changed. Whatever the reason, it's time to make some tough decisions. Do you try to revive the product with a major overhaul? Do you find a niche market? Or do you gracefully retire it and focus on something new? This stage is inevitable, but it doesn't have to be sad!

Remember those old flip phones? Or how about cassette tapes? They've been largely replaced by newer technologies and are definitely in the decline stage. Even Blockbuster, once a video rental giant, fell into decline due to the rise of streaming services.

Why is All This Important?

Knowing about the Product Life Cycle isn't just cool trivia; it's super useful for businesses! It helps them make smart decisions about:

  • Marketing: What kind of advertising makes sense at each stage?
  • Pricing: Should you charge a premium price when you're first launching, or offer discounts to gain market share?
  • Product Development: When should you start working on the next generation of your product?
  • Inventory Management: How much stock should you keep on hand at each stage?

It's about being strategic and anticipating what's next.

More Fun Examples to Ponder

Think about the evolution of video game consoles. Each new generation goes through its own life cycle, with the introduction of new technology, a period of rapid growth, years of dominance, and eventual decline as the next big thing arrives. What about fashion trends? They're a classic example of a short-lived product life cycle – popular one minute, forgotten the next!
